Greek Saganaki Cheese Snack (Printer-friendly)

Crisp-fried Greek cheese with lemon and oregano offers a savory, quick-to-make delight.

# What You'll Need:

→ Cheese

01 - 7 oz firm Greek cheese (kasseri, kefalotyri, halloumi), sliced 0.4 inch thick

→ For Coating

02 - 2 tbsp all-purpose flour or gluten-free flour

→ For Frying

03 - 2 tbsp olive oil

→ To Serve

04 - 1 lemon, cut into wedges
05 - ½ tsp dried oregano
06 - Freshly ground black pepper, to taste

# Directions:

01 - Pat cheese slices dry using paper towels to remove excess moisture.
02 - Lightly dredge each slice in flour, shaking off any excess coating.
03 - Warm olive oil in a non-stick skillet over medium-high heat.
04 - Place cheese slices in skillet and fry 1 to 2 minutes per side until golden and crisp.
05 - Remove fried cheese and drain briefly on paper towels to absorb excess oil.
06 - Transfer to serving plate, sprinkle with oregano and black pepper, then serve immediately with lemon wedges.

02 -
  • Moisture is the silent killer—even a tiny bit of dampness on the cheese will prevent proper crisping, so that paper towel step genuinely matters.
  • The difference between medium and medium-high heat is the difference between a triumph and a disappointment; err on the side of hotter rather than cooler.
  • Lemon is not optional; it transforms the dish from flat and heavy to bright and alive.
03 -
  • A non-stick skillet genuinely changes the game here—stainless steel tends to grab the cheese and refuse to let it flip cleanly.
  • If your cheese is coming straight from the refrigerator, let it sit at room temperature for a few minutes first; cold cheese needs longer to reach that melted-inside-crispy-outside balance.
